BACKGROUND: Salinity stress is a major constraint to citrus productivity, which is adversely affecting physiological, biochemical and cellular processes. The use of salt-tolerant rootstocks offers a sustainable strategy to mitigate these effects; however, rootstock breeding requires a comprehensive understanding of genotype-specific tolerance mechanisms operating across multiple biological levels.
